nervous system
• onion bulb structures are seen indicating myelin degeneration and regeneration
• however, stacking of myelin sheaths in compact myelin is unaffected
• noncompact myelin structures are more abundant
• myelin sheaths are thicker at P15 and P30 and myelin continues to grow radially such that the mean myelin area in peripheral nerves at P90 is increased 6-fold
• increase in myelin thickness is particularly pronounced in small-diameter fibers
• aberrant paranodal myelin (tomaculi) and infolded myelin loops
• increase in the diameter of sciatic nerves due to massive hypermyelination and reduced axonal packing
• myelination begins prematurely and mice show continuous myelin growth
• increase in the number of myelinated fibers per field at P0
• myelin abnormalities are seen at P30-P90 but not at P15, indicating that they result from massive hypermylination
• treatment with the mTORC1 inhibitor everolimus dampens myelin growth in the nerves of mutants and completely rescues the decreased axonal packing
• ratio of compound action potentials in myelinated A and nonmyelinated C fibers (A/C fiber waves) is reduced and there is a reduction in numbers of active mechanoreceptive units after P60 indicating that many myelinated axons are not conducting
• D-hair mechanoreceptors show increased conduction velocities at P30, however no differences were seen after P60
• however, conduction velocities of other mechanosensory fibers are unchanged
